summary |
shortlog |
log |
commit | commitdiff |
tree
raw |
patch |
inline | side by side (from parent 1:
9ca439f)
not be available.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@100097
138bc75d-0d04-0410-961f-
82ee72b054a4
+2005-05-24 Nick Clifton <nickc@redhat.com>
+
+ * config/rs6000/rs6000-c.c (rs6000_cpu_cpp_builtins): Define
+ __NO_FPRS__ when 'f' class registers will not be available.
+
2005-05-24 Kazuhiro Inaoka <inaoka.kazuhiro@renesas.com>
* config/m32r/m32r.c (m32r_expand_block_move): Return 0 if
2005-05-24 Kazuhiro Inaoka <inaoka.kazuhiro@renesas.com>
* config/m32r/m32r.c (m32r_expand_block_move): Return 0 if
+ /* Let the compiled code know if 'f' class registers will not be available. */
+ if (TARGET_SOFT_FLOAT || !TARGET_FPRS)
+ builtin_define ("__NO_FPRS__");
+
targetm.resolve_overloaded_builtin = altivec_resolve_overloaded_builtin;
}
targetm.resolve_overloaded_builtin = altivec_resolve_overloaded_builtin;
}